Front-End Developer
Angular
TypeScript
Java
Docker
GitHub Actions
Project
Leroy Merlin Studio is a platform designed to support individuals in their renovation projects. It organizes the process into five key steps: online project simulation, consultation with an expert, home visits, detailed quote and schedule delivery, and weekly work progress tracking. The platform aims to simplify the customer experience while enhancing internal team efficiency.
Context
A long-term project carried out within a team of 10 people, including 7 developers. As a senior front-end developer, I was responsible for validating pull requests and ensuring code quality. The project required close collaboration with the team to continuously improve the platform.
Responsibilities
Front-End Development
- Implemented new user-oriented features
- Refactored code to improve structure
- Implemented Figma designs using Angular components
- Resolved critical production bugs
- Enhanced the quote generation platform
Quality and Testing
- Established cross-testing across the application
- Validated and reviewed pull requests
- Maintained code quality standards
Continuous Integration
- Optimized GitHub Actions pipelines
- Managed development and pre-production environments
- Configured Jenkins and Turbine tools